Kerry’s 5-minute salad
This dressing is enough for 4 large salads or 6 smaller salads.
Dressing
In a small jar add the following ingredients:
1/2 teaspoon sea salt (to taste)
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per (to taste)
a big pinch of chili pepper flakes (optional)
1-2 cloves garlic, minced
3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ons raw, unfiltered apple cider vinegar
Put the lid on the jar, shake vigorously until well blended.
Pour over your favorite baby greens salad mix.
Toss and serve! That’s it! Enjoy!

3. If you have any leftover dressing, it will keep in the fridge for a day or two. Remove from the fridge about 15 minutes before you plan to use it as it can get a bit thick when chilled. Add a tiny bit of olive oil and apple cider vinegar, shake vigorously, pour over salad, toss salad to coat ingredients and serve!
